乳酸清除率评估重症创伤患者预后的临床研究

, PP. 1139-1141

Keywords: 乳酸清除率,创伤,预后

Full-Text   Cite this paper   Add to My Lib

Abstract:

【】 目的 评估乳酸清除率与重症创伤患者预后的关系。 方法 回顾性分析2010年1-6月收住曲靖市第一人民医院ICU科的37例重症创伤患者的初始血乳酸值、第2次血乳酸值、乳酸清除率及患者的预后,将患者分为存活组和死亡组,比较两组患者初始血乳酸值、乳酸清除率的差异。 结果 两组患者年龄、性别、初始血乳酸值差异无统计学意义(P>0.05)。存活组血乳酸清除率(48.26±21.57)%明显高于死亡组(11.71±20.88)%,差异有统计学意义(P0.05)betweenthetwogroups.Comparedwithnon-survivors,thesurvivorshadasignificantlyhigherlactateclearance(48.26±21.57)%vs.(11.71±20.88)%,P<0.001.Patientswithalactateclearancehigherthanorequalto13%hadasensitivityof96%,specificityof80%,forpredictingsurvival. Conclusion Lactateclearanceratecanbeusedtopredicttheprognosisofseveretrauma.
